The new router has 18 wired ports, including 16x Gigabit Ethernet ports and two 10G SFP+ cages. It also has a RJ-45 console port on the front panel.
Like all CCR devices, it comes in a classic white 1U rackmount case. Built-in dual redundant power supplies are included, so you have one less thing to worry about. And, of course, there is active cooling to keep things nice and cool.
Each group of 8 Gigabit Ethernet ports is connected to a separate Marvell Amethyst family switch-chip. Each switch chip has a 10 Gbps full-duplex line connected to the CPU. The same goes for each SFP+ cage - a separate 10 Gbps full-duplex line. Boards come with 4GB of DDR4 RAM and 128MB of NAND storage.
So as you can see - no bottlenecks. As long as the CPU can handle the processing, all ports can reach wire speed. And this CPU is a beast that can handle a lot. Product code | CCR2004-16G-2S+ | |
---|---|---|
CPU | AL32400 1.7 GHz | |
CPU architecture | ARM 64bit | |
CPU core count | 4 | |
Size of RAM | 4 GB | |
RAM type | DDR4 | |
Storage | 128 MB, NAND | |
Number of 1G Ethernet ports | 16 | |
Number of 10G SFP+ ports | 2 | |
Operating system | RouterOS v7 only | |
Switch chip model | 88E6191X, 88E619X | |
Dimensions | 443 x 210 x 44 mm | |
Operating temperature | -20°C to +60°C |
Number of DC inputs | 2 |
---|---|
AC input range | 100-240 V |
Max power consumption (without attachments) | 35 W |
Max power consumption | 48 W |
Certification | CE, FCC, IC |
